History


Ralo Productions is the name of the company that Lloyd Vandenberg, Managing Director of Glendale Group, founded with his brother Raymond (the Ra) in 1980. Both brothers started to organize business events, especially mini fairgrounds at company parties in association with Joop van den Ende Productions. In this way Lloyd and Raymond came into contact with the television world through which their network expanded by building dance floors and sceneries, arranging lights and building game attractions for the ‘Showbizzquiz’. In addition to this the two brothers had a letter studio and they exploited various slot machines throughout the whole country. In 1988 Raymond and Lloyd decided to end their cooperation, after which Lloyd continued Ralo Productions on one’s own.

In the nineties business was booming in the field of events. Ralo Productions was flourishing. Also for Schiphol the company frequently arranged various events, among the openings of the piers. Through the broad network that was build as a result of this, it became clear that there was a tender for a number of locations at Schiphol Plaza. The company submitted a business plan for a cocktail/juice bar, for which a concession was delivered in 1995. Juggle Juice Bar was a fact at that time.

Throughout the years Ralo Productions brought food service more and more into focus.This, combined with a good portion of ambition, let to the opening of various food service concepts at Schiphol and abroad. One and the same covering name for all food service outlets was desirable, especially in the field of business administration. This resulted in the realization of Glendale Group B.V., a company that has more than 120 employees nowadays. And this number of employees is growing every day.
